DESCRIPTION
These risers are designed to lift and rotate your Behringer MODEL D for ergonomic use on a desktop or other flat work surface. Each riser can be mounted with the two forward facing side panel screws currently installed on your MODEL D - no additional hardware required.
Optional features include 1) a decorative inlay that can be customized with your own designs and lettering, and 2) an anti-slip surface to keep your MODEL D from sliding across your desk. The inlay is a small 3D printed part that looks nice as an accent when printed in a separate color. You can either use the included inlay design or download the .f3d version and add your own customization. The anti-slip surface is a simple 3/16 x 5/16 x 1/16 rubber o-ring that mounts in the feet of each riser. Most local hardware stores should have these on hand and you will need 4 in total.
